The Bombay High Court dismissed L&T Finance Limited's execution application against Precision Engineers and Fabricators Pvt. Ltd., declaring the underlying arbitral award void-ab-initio because the sole arbitrator's appointment was unilateral. Relying on a recent Supreme Court judgment, the court held that arbitral awards can be set aside even at the execution stage when the arbitrator's appointment violates procedural requirements. The parties were permitted to initiate fresh arbitration proceedings with the prior limitation period excluded.
